Besides learning Scratch and creating mini games, the purpose of the trial class is to allow your child the opportunity to try out programming and see if he or she has any interest in this area. Regardless of whether your child joins the programming or IT field or not later on in life, learning programming is beneficial as it hones a child's logical thinking and creativity as he or she sets out to solve the problem, and also learn teamwork and collaborative skills as he or she work together with their peers in class.

Teaching Philosophy

This idea that kids will learn anything that they want to, when they are given the freedom to create, inspires and drives Computhink teaching philosophy. The philosophy is influenced by the work of Sugata Mitra (Educational Researcher) whose research demonstrates the effect that a child’s innate curiosity and interest have on learning complex subjects outside the normal school environment. The key word here is interest. By itself, it is a simple word and concept, easily understood, but not so easy to influence, especially with children.
